Home
last modified time | relevance | path

Searched refs:incompat (Results 1 – 11 of 11) sorted by relevance

/linux-6.6.21/fs/erofs/
Dinternal.h244 EROFS_FEATURE_FUNCS(zero_padding, incompat, INCOMPAT_ZERO_PADDING)
245 EROFS_FEATURE_FUNCS(compr_cfgs, incompat, INCOMPAT_COMPR_CFGS)
246 EROFS_FEATURE_FUNCS(big_pcluster, incompat, INCOMPAT_BIG_PCLUSTER)
247 EROFS_FEATURE_FUNCS(chunked_file, incompat, INCOMPAT_CHUNKED_FILE)
248 EROFS_FEATURE_FUNCS(device_table, incompat, INCOMPAT_DEVICE_TABLE)
249 EROFS_FEATURE_FUNCS(compr_head2, incompat, INCOMPAT_COMPR_HEAD2)
250 EROFS_FEATURE_FUNCS(ztailpacking, incompat, INCOMPAT_ZTAILPACKING)
251 EROFS_FEATURE_FUNCS(fragments, incompat, INCOMPAT_FRAGMENTS)
252 EROFS_FEATURE_FUNCS(dedupe, incompat, INCOMPAT_DEDUPE)
253 EROFS_FEATURE_FUNCS(xattr_prefixes, incompat, INCOMPAT_XATTR_PREFIXES)
/linux-6.6.21/fs/jbd2/
Djournal.c2210 unsigned long ro, unsigned long incompat) in jbd2_journal_check_used_features() argument
2214 if (!compat && !ro && !incompat) in jbd2_journal_check_used_features()
2223 ((be32_to_cpu(sb->s_feature_incompat) & incompat) == incompat)) in jbd2_journal_check_used_features()
2241 unsigned long ro, unsigned long incompat) in jbd2_journal_check_available_features() argument
2243 if (!compat && !ro && !incompat) in jbd2_journal_check_available_features()
2251 (incompat & JBD2_KNOWN_INCOMPAT_FEATURES) == incompat) in jbd2_journal_check_available_features()
2299 unsigned long ro, unsigned long incompat) in jbd2_journal_set_features() argument
2302 ((incompat & (f)) && !(sb->s_feature_incompat & cpu_to_be32(f))) in jbd2_journal_set_features()
2307 if (jbd2_journal_check_used_features(journal, compat, ro, incompat)) in jbd2_journal_set_features()
2310 if (!jbd2_journal_check_available_features(journal, compat, ro, incompat)) in jbd2_journal_set_features()
[all …]
/linux-6.6.21/fs/overlayfs/
Dreaddir.c1085 bool incompat = false; in ovl_workdir_cleanup_recurse() local
1097 incompat = true; in ovl_workdir_cleanup_recurse()
1112 } else if (incompat) { in ovl_workdir_cleanup_recurse()
/linux-6.6.21/fs/btrfs/
Ddisk-io.c3072 u64 incompat = btrfs_super_incompat_flags(disk_super); in btrfs_check_features() local
3076 if (incompat & ~BTRFS_FEATURE_INCOMPAT_SUPP) { in btrfs_check_features()
3079 incompat); in btrfs_check_features()
3084 if ((incompat & BTRFS_FEATURE_INCOMPAT_MIXED_GROUPS) && in btrfs_check_features()
3093 incompat |= BTRFS_FEATURE_INCOMPAT_MIXED_BACKREF; in btrfs_check_features()
3097 incompat |= BTRFS_FEATURE_INCOMPAT_COMPRESS_LZO; in btrfs_check_features()
3099 incompat |= BTRFS_FEATURE_INCOMPAT_COMPRESS_ZSTD; in btrfs_check_features()
3106 incompat |= BTRFS_FEATURE_INCOMPAT_BIG_METADATA; in btrfs_check_features()
3156 btrfs_set_super_incompat_flags(disk_super, incompat); in btrfs_check_features()
/linux-6.6.21/Documentation/filesystems/ext4/
Dsuper.rst250 - Size of group descriptors, in bytes, if the 64bit incompat feature flag
607 the journal, JBD2 incompat feature
Djournal.rst298 The journal incompat features are any combination of the following:
/linux-6.6.21/fs/ext4/
Dsuper.c4082 int compat, incompat; in set_journal_csum_feature_set() local
4088 incompat = JBD2_FEATURE_INCOMPAT_CSUM_V3; in set_journal_csum_feature_set()
4092 incompat = 0; in set_journal_csum_feature_set()
4103 incompat); in set_journal_csum_feature_set()
4107 incompat); in set_journal_csum_feature_set()
/linux-6.6.21/drivers/block/
Drbd.c5532 __le64 incompat; in _rbd_dev_v2_snap_features() member
5550 unsup = le64_to_cpu(features_buf.incompat) & ~RBD_FEATURES_SUPPORTED; in _rbd_dev_v2_snap_features()
5562 (unsigned long long)le64_to_cpu(features_buf.incompat)); in _rbd_dev_v2_snap_features()
/linux-6.6.21/Documentation/filesystems/
Doverlayfs.rst717 "$workdir/work/incompat/volatile" is created. During next mount, overlay
Dxfs-online-fsck-design.rst4042 | In short, log incompat features protect the log contents against kernels |
4044 | Unlike the other superblock feature bits, log incompat bits are |
4058 | Filesystem code signals its intention to use a log incompat feature in a |
4061 | The code supporting a log incompat feature should create wrapper |
4076 | log incompat features and provide convenience wrappers around the |
/linux-6.6.21/drivers/block/drbd/
Ddrbd_receiver.c5320 goto incompat; in drbd_do_features()
5338 incompat: in drbd_do_features()